WebThe red LED flasher flashes at around 2 Hz. When the red flasher is ON the transistor is switched ON, allowing current to flow through resistor R. The resistor shunts current from the ultra-bright LED, causing it to go OFF. The resistor value is selected to lower the voltage across the ultra-bright LED to about 2.25 volts. WebSep 28, 2016 · From my understanding, there is no individual flasher unit. All the indicator flashing is controlled by the BCM (Body Control Module) and cannot be changed to accommodate LED turn signals. The only way I have seen, is to use the resistors to trick the BCM into thinking that the standard globe is being used.
